Fascinating, make sure you have the absolute latest edition of I Tunes (I've had experience with people not being able to play their library without having the newest version.) If you have a good internet connection then you may want to simply un-install Itunes and do a completely new download and install. Make sure the volume slider on I Tunes is not all the way down. Also if these don't work try going to your "Sound" applet in control panel;
-under the playback tab click the properties button (be sure your speakers are selected)
-move over to the advanced tab
-be sure both boxes are checked under exclusive mode:
(allow application to take exclusive control of this device) and (give exclusive mode applications priority)
I hope some of this helpful. Thanks.

Hissing from computer speakers and they are new

Hello
A hissing sound indicates the speaker amplifier has no input from the computer sound card, check to make sure the speakers are hooked up to the correct port for audio out to the speaker input, the Audio output to the speaker is the GREEN mini RCA jack on the back of the computer.
